São Paulo, Number 1 State in Brazil Sérgio Costa Director April 5th, 2013

Mission Being the gateway to new investments or expansion of existing businesses, generating innovation, employment and income, in addition to the continuous improvement of the competitive environment and of the image of the State of São Paulo

Promotion of the image of the State of Sao Paulo Actions for the Promotion of Competitiveness Labor training, Taxation, Innovation, Infrastructure and Licensing Studying and proposing public policies Institutional Activities Reception of foreign delegations and organization of international missions Support and guidance for municipal governments Investment Projects Technical support and orientation to investors: site location, taxes, infrastructure Contact with public and private institutions aiming as investment facilitation Business Prospection Identification of sectors and companies with investment potential Areas of Activity SP

Our Customers Portfolio of projects Number of projects: 55 Potential Investments: BRL billion Potential direct jobs: 15,830 Sectors: automotive, food, oil and gas, energy, machinery and equipment, information technology and communication, solid waste and biotechnology. Origin: United States, China, South Korea, Spain, Japan, Italy, England, France and Brazil. * The names of these companies are kept confidential in compliance with NDA signed with Investe São Paulo April 2013 Direct Jobs: 40,536 Announced Investments: USD 8,981 billion

São Paulo state in the Brazilian Context

Brasil and São Paulo Comparison Territory 3% Population22% GDP nominal 33% GDP per capita per capita 1,5X bigger São Paulo´s Share Source: IBGE, Banco Central e SEADE Exchange Rate: US$ 1 = R$ 1.95

São Paulo Competitive Advantages Largest Consumer Market in LATAM Skilled Workforce Supply Chain World-class Infrastructure Largest Brazilian Investor in R&D Environmental Responsibility

São Paulo Consumer Market Map Source: IPC marketing 2012 R$ billion 50,2% 49,8% The largest brazilian consumer market USD 390 billion

São Paulo’s share of the Brazilian output 33,52% Petroleum products 36,76% Biofuels 47,77% Chemicals 55,28% Machinery and equipment 58,13% Electronic components 58,34% Computer equipment and peripherals 60% Communications equipment 67.83% Manufacture of pharmaceutical chemicals and pharmaceuticals 72.92% Electromedical and electrotherapeutic apparatus and equipment of irradiation 95.84% Aircraft Selected Sectors

R&D / Innovation USP, Unicamp and Unesp International recognition All over the state USD 616 million annual budget Fundação de Amparo à Pesquisa Científica e Tecnológica (Fapesp) 3 universities among the ones that most develop scientific research in Brazil 19 research institutes 19 initiatives of Technological Parks More than 13% of the São Paulo State revenue is used in high quality education, research and development. The State also hosts federal universities and research institutions.
